Trunk should be locked?
On my 2015 ES350 it seems that when I have my car locked and the key inside my home I can still walk up to the trunk and push the button (located under the trunk lip) and the trunk will open. I would think this should not be possible with both the doors locked and the key inside the house. Any ideas? Thanks.

In the manual for the 2017 ES, it says that there is a personalized setting that allows you to choose between having the trunk lock when the car's doors are locked or, alternatively, to not have the trunk lock when the car's doors are locked. The default is to have the trunk lock when the doors are locked. The setting is explained on page 543 of the 2017 ES manual. I'm not sure whether the same personalized setting applies to the 2015 ES, but, if it does, it would be explained in the manual with other personalized settings. The page number is likely different than it is in my 2017 manual.
That particular personalized setting is listed as one of the ones that can only changed by the dealer. Again, I don't know if the same setting applies to the 2015, but, if it does and if it was ever changed from the default, that could be the reason why the trunk is remaining unlocked even when the doors are locked.
